Here's a list of bike trail benefits courtesy of the site for the Dell Rapids Trailway . Frankly, this list can also be applied to virtually any bike trail, path or route so it's worth noting here.

Benefit of bike trails:

* Safety
Allows a place to exercise that is away from motor vehicles.
* General health
Exercise from activities like walking, jogging, biking, in-line skating as well as mental health benefits from being outdoors.
* Rehabilitation programs
Provides a setting for therapy.
* Conservation
Inspires non-motorized vehicle use, conserving fuel and lessening pollution.
* Education
Historical signs, nature interpretive markers, trail guides provide an appreciation for local history & the opportunity for teaching beyond the classroom setting.
* Community cohesiveness
All generations can participate in and benefit from biking & walking.
* City economy
Trail use results creates a new draw for tourism and leads to sales of food, refreshments, activewear, sporting goods, etc.

Equally fitting is their list of beneficiaries of bike trails :

* Elderly walkers, people with physical limitations, and parents with strollers (paved surface, level walking paths, benches)
* Businesses (increased traffic from campground/ball field events)
* Nature lovers, bird watchers, hikers, picnickers, campers, fisherman, canoeists, photographers, artists (access to scenic areas)
* Tourists (additional draw to other area attractions)
* Families (free, wholesome activities)
* School children (safe pathways to schools and parks)
* School track & cross-country teams (trail available for practices)
* Exercisers (fitness & general cardiovascular health)
